[packages/pyside-setup] - fix removal of ffmpeg copies

baggins baggins at pld-linux.org
Mon Dec 30 14:40:13 CET 2024


commit 7f2484622d665ec8b0d9fec6e04e5ad8b9da7c2b
Author: Jan Rękorajski <baggins at pld-linux.org>
Date:   Mon Dec 30 15:39:58 2024 +0100

    - fix removal of ffmpeg copies

 pyside-setup.spec |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)
---
diff --git a/pyside-setup.spec b/pyside-setup.spec
index c71b4d3..837ebcf 100644
--- a/pyside-setup.spec
+++ b/pyside-setup.spec
@@ -66,6 +66,7 @@ BuildRequires:	patchelf
 BuildRequires:	python3-devel >= 1:3.2
 BuildRequires:	qt6-assistant
 BuildRequires:	qt6-designer
+BuildRequires:	qt6-linguist
 BuildRequires:	qt6-qtdeclarative
 BuildRequires:	qt6-qttools
 BuildRequires:	qt6-quick3d
@@ -181,7 +182,7 @@ CXXFLAGS="${CXXFLAGS:-%rpmcppflags %rpmcxxflags}"; export CXXFLAGS; \
 	--reuse-build
 
 # Atrocious (dereferencing all symlinks) copy of ffmpeg libs.
-%{__rm} -r $RPM_BUILD_ROOT%{py3_sitedir}/PySide6/Qt/lib
+%{__rm} $RPM_BUILD_ROOT%{py3_sitedir}/PySide6/Qt/lib/lib{avcodec,avformat,avutil,swresample,swscale}.so*
 
 # Fix main libs location
 %{__mv} $RPM_BUILD_ROOT%{py3_sitedir}/PySide6/libpyside6*.abi3.so.6.8 $RPM_BUILD_ROOT%{_libdir}/
================================================================

---- gitweb:

http://git.pld-linux.org/gitweb.cgi/packages/pyside-setup.git/commitdiff/7f2484622d665ec8b0d9fec6e04e5ad8b9da7c2b



More information about the pld-cvs-commit mailing list